Understanding BoP and Its Importance

Balance of Performance (BoP) adjustments are crucial in auto racing, ensuring a level playing field among different car models and manufacturers. These adjustments affect a vehicle’s performance through weight changes, engine power restrictions, and aerodynamics. Keeping up with real-time BoP changes is key for teams to strategize effectively.

One recent example is the GT World Challenge Europe, where BoP adjustments were applied just before the second Sprint Cup race in Zandvoort. This involved tweaking the Audi R8 LMS GT3, Ferrari 296 GT3, and Lamborghini Huracán GT3 EVO2, showcasing how dynamic adjustments can influence race outcomes.

Implications for Teams and Manufacturers

BoP adjustments have significant implications for both teams and manufacturers. Teams must adapt quickly to ensure they remain competitive, often employing advanced simulation software to test various scenarios.

Manufacturers face the challenge of designing cars that can perform well under varying BoP conditions. This requires a focus not only on speed but also on adaptability, keeping an open channel with race organizers for timely updates.

FAQ Section

Why are BoP Adjustments Important?

To maintain competitive balance, ensuring no single manufacturer or car dominates due to technological or economic power.

How are BoP Adjustments Decided?

Based on scientific analysis of performance data and input from race organizers, taking into account factors like lap times, pit strategies, and overall race performance.

What Impact Do BoP Adjustments Have on Racing?

They level the playing field, enhance race excitement by enabling closer competition, and ensure sustainability by keeping all teams in contention.
